Understanding Agent Performance Metrics

Agent performance metrics provide concrete data about an agentโ€™s effectiveness. These metrics include average days on market, list-to-sale price ratios, and total sales volume. Understanding these can help you gauge an agentโ€™s ability to sell homes quickly and at competitive prices.

Days on Market:

A lower average suggests that the agent is skilled at pricing homes correctly and marketing them effectively.

List-to-Sale Price Ratio:

This metric shows how close the final sale price is to the initial listing price. A higher ratio indicates strong negotiation skills.

Sales Volume:

While a high volume can indicate success, ensure the agent isnโ€™t spread too thin, affecting personalized service.

Comparing Commission Rates

Commission rates are a vital consideration when selecting a listing agent. Typically, rates range from 5-6% of the homeโ€™s sale price, split between the buyerโ€™s and sellerโ€™s agents. However, these rates can vary based on market conditions and the agentโ€™s experience.

Negotiate Wisely:

Some agents may be open to negotiating their commission, especially in a competitive market.

Understand Value**: Consider what services are included in the commission. Does the agent offer professional photography, staging, or extensive marketing?

Long-term Savings:

Sometimes, paying a slightly higher commission to a top-performing agent can result in a faster sale and higher final price, ultimately saving you money.

FAQ Section

What should I ask a listing agent during an interview?

Ask about their experience in Temescal Valley, recent sales data, marketing strategy, and how they handle negotiations. Understanding their approach will help you gauge their suitability for your needs.

How can I verify an agentโ€™s credentials?

Check their license status with the California Department of Real Estate. You can also ask for references from past clients to get firsthand insights into their reliability and effectiveness.

Is it better to choose a solo agent or a team?

Both have advantages. A solo agent may offer personalized service, while a team might provide a broader range of expertise and resources. Consider your preferences and the complexity of your sale.
